I am trying to replace the over the centre spring on my 72 Duster 340 4 speed. Has any one done this with any this that has ideas how to get the old spring out? I have washers in the new one ready to go but the one in the car I am having issues getting a screw driver in it. Thanks
 
I would assume if you push down the clutch at some point the spring will open up and you can get some washers in

same goes for the old one/one currently installed- stuff that prick with as many washers as you can then push the clutch in and try to pry off one side of the spring.

I am just looking at the manual & see a hook at the short end of the spring that I believe a large screw driver & a pair of channel locks will release the end of the spring.

With my pedals out of the car, I was able to remove the old spring with no issue, it practically fell right off, it would be just as easy to reinstall if needed.
 
The spring is extended furthest at the center position.
Definitely tight up there, especially with the HD pedal set......
